Recognizing the Importance of Professional Credentials



The field of art evaluation is not regulated by the state similarly as realty or medication. This indicates anybody can practically call themselves an appraiser, making it essential for collection agencies to do their due persistance. When you start your search in Oakland, try to find specialists who come from recognized national companies. These teams require their members to go through comprehensive training and follow a strict code of ethics. A competent appraiser will commonly hold a certification that shows they have passed rigorous exams and preserve their education and learning through routine updates.



Among the most essential criteria to search for is compliance with the Uniform Standards of Professional Appraisal Practice. These standards make sure that the assessment process is taken care of with impartiality and neutrality. In 2026, many local professionals are additionally focusing on new academic requirements concerning appraisal predisposition and fair real estate regulations, reflecting a more comprehensive commitment to equity within the industry. By choosing a person with these credentials, you ensure that your appraisal report will certainly take on the analysis of insurer, tax obligation authorities, and legal professionals.

Transparency and Ethical Fee Structures



A reliable appraiser will certainly constantly be transparent regarding their pricing and the scope of their job. You need to avoid any expert that uses to charge a percent of the evaluated value. This method develops a clear dispute of passion, as it incentivizes the evaluator to blow up the worth to increase their own fee. Instead, many qualified experts in the Bay Area charge a per hour price or a level charge per job. They must give you with a created contract that details precisely what services they will carry out and what the last report will certainly consist of.



Ethical criteria likewise dictate that an evaluator must not use to purchase the items they are evaluating. Their duty is to supply an impartial point of view of value, not to act as a supplier trying to find a bargain. This splitting up of roles is essential to maintaining depend on. If you are considering marketing your items with a design auction in the future, your appraiser ought to be able to direct you on the very best locations for your details pieces without having a financial stake in the result. This unbiased recommendations is what you are spending for when you employ an expert.



Getting ready for the Appraisal Process



When you have actually picked an evaluator, you can assist the procedure step smoothly by gathering any kind of documents you have for your collection. This consists of initial acquisition receipts, gallery invoices, certificates of authenticity, and any type of documents of previous reconstructions. If a piece has a noteworthy history, such as being showed in a gallery or owned by a famous number, this information-- called provenance-- can significantly boost its worth. Having these information prepared permits the evaluator to concentrate their time on study and analysis as opposed to management tasks.



During the site check out, guarantee that the art work is conveniently obtainable and well-lit. The appraiser will likely take thorough photos and measurements of each product. They might also use specialized devices like ultraviolet lights to look for surprise repairs or changes. Don't be afraid to ask inquiries throughout this see. A great expert will more than happy to describe their methodology and the aspects they are taking into consideration. This interaction aids you recognize real nature of your collection and provides comfort that your possessions are being taken care of with care.



Finalizing the Valuation Report



The end result of your partnership will certainly be an official appraisal report. This file must be detailed and well-organized, including a clear summary of each thing, its condition, and the reasoning find more behind the appointed value. In 2026, these records are progressively electronic, allowing for high-resolution photos and simple sharing with insurance coverage representatives or legal advice. Make sure that the report explicitly specifies the "desired usage," whether it is for insurance coverage substitute worth, inheritance tax functions, or prospective liquidation.



A high-quality record functions as a long-term document of your collection's worth at a particular time. Due to the fact that the art market is constantly shifting, it is generally suggested to have your collection re-evaluated every three to 5 years. This ensures that your insurance policy protection stays adequate which your estate planning reflects existing market truths.
